处理网站死链问题需遵循系统化流程,以下是分步骤解决方案:
-
检测识别
- 使用专业工具(如Google Search Console、Xenu或在线死链检测平台)定期扫描全站链接,重点关注返回404状态码的页面。对于大型网站,建议按频道或功能模块分区检测,优先处理高流量页面中的死链。
-
原因诊断
- 资源变动:检查目标页面是否被删除或移动。
- 配置错误:服务器设置不当可能导致链接失效。
- 域名/路径变更:新旧域名切换时未正确重定向。
- 人为失误:输入错误或拼写偏差导致链接不可达。
-
分类修复
- 替换有效链接:若原内容仍存在但路径错误,直接更新为正确URL。
- 301重定向:对已迁移或永久删除的页面,设置跳转至相关替代内容,保留SEO权重。
- 创建404页面:设计包含站点地图链接、搜索框及返回首页入口的友好提示页,降低用户流失率。
-
服务器优化
- 核查服务器配置文件,修正规则冲突或权限限制;清理过期缓存策略,避免因缓存机制导致死链反复出现。
-
持续监控维护
- 建立月度审查机制,结合自动化工具实时监测新产生的死链。同步更新XML站点地图并向搜索引擎提交,加速索引修正。通过Hotjar等热力图工具分析用户点击行为,预判潜在失效链接风险。